[arch-commits] Commit in python-serpent/trunk (PKGBUILD)
Alexander Rødseth
arodseth at archlinux.org
Tue May 11 11:26:15 UTC 2021
Date: Tuesday, May 11, 2021 @ 11:26:14
Author: arodseth
Revision: 929976
Add a check() that runs setup.py test
Modified:
python-serpent/trunk/PKGBUILD
----------+
PKGBUILD | 18 ++++++++++--------
1 file changed, 10 insertions(+), 8 deletions(-)
Modified: PKGBUILD
===================================================================
--- PKGBUILD 2021-05-11 11:19:40 UTC (rev 929975)
+++ PKGBUILD 2021-05-11 11:26:14 UTC (rev 929976)
@@ -3,21 +3,23 @@
pkgname=python-serpent
pkgver=1.30.2
-pkgrel=3
+pkgrel=4
pkgdesc='Serializer for literal Python expressions'
url='https://github.com/irmen/Serpent'
arch=(any)
license=(MIT)
depends=(python)
-makedepends=(git)
-source=("git+$url#commit=60877b581069d4e592531968edd6c1468c822b0a")
-md5sums=('SKIP')
+makedepends=(git python-attrs python-pytz python-testtools)
+source=("serpent::git+$url#commit=60877b581069d4e592531968edd6c1468c822b0a") # tag: 1.30.2
+b2sums=(SKIP)
+check() {
+ cd serpent
+ python setup.py test
+}
+
package() {
- cd Serpent
+ cd serpent
python setup.py install --root="$pkgdir" --optimize=1
install -Dm644 LICENSE "$pkgdir/usr/share/licenses/$pkgname/LICENSE"
}
-
-# getver: -u 2 anaconda.org/conda-forge/serpent
-# vim: ts=2 sw=2 et:
More information about the arch-commits
mailing list